A rare Halal-certified ramen restaurant in Japan
HALAL RAMEN SHINJUKU-TEI is a restaurant where Muslim customers can enjoy Japanese ramen with peace of mind. There are multiple stores in Tokyo and Sapporo. Most stores have obtained the strict halal certification "NAHA." Regardless of whether they have certification or not, everything served at HALAL RAMEN SHINJUKU-TEI is halal.

Ramen made with Halal Wagyu beef
The most famous dish at HALAL RAMEN SHINJUKU-TEI is their rich ramen soup made with the highest quality Halal Wagyu beef. They also have other dishes such as Chicken Ramen made with chicken bones. All of their menu items are Halal certified and do not contain any pork or alcohol.


Don't just try the ramen, be sure to try the halal wagyu beef sushi!
HALAL RAMEN SHINJUKU-TEI is not only proud of its ramen. The sushi made with halal wagyu beef is also a must-try. Before eating, the staff will grill the meat in front of you, making it melt-in-your-mouth delicious. This performance will surely add to the deliciousness of the dish.

A prayer space is also available. A place for Muslims
The stores have multilingual staff, so international travelers can feel at ease. Prayer spaces are also available . Some stores are equipped with not only prayer spaces but also foot washing areas for wudu. Muslim considerations are evident throughout the stores.
